Why bring up your abuse after all these years? This question is always a slap in the face to abuse survivors. "Why bring it up after all these years"? "Can't you let by-gones by by-gones"? Oh, if it were only that simple! The truth is that the devastation of the abuse has continued to haunt the victim and has affected every area of her life. The shame and fear has kept her silent. At the point she finally has the courage to speak out, she is met with these stupid comments from people who don't have a clue. While the abuser has continued on his merry way, life has stopped for the victim. It is so important for them to speak out about their abuse. It is the first step in their recovery. As long as they are silent, their abusers has power over them. No matter how many years it took for them to speak out, they should be met with compassion and love. The last thing they need is to be re-victimized by careless and insensitive comments.
